SolarWinds announces winners of 2025 EMEA Partner Awards

SolarWinds has shared the winners of its 2025 EMEA Partner Awards. The awards recognise the impressive growth and dedication within the distribution and reseller partner community over the past year.

 “I am beyond grateful to all our partners for their dedication over this past year,” said Laurent Delattre, Vice President of Sales, EMEA, SolarWinds. “We’re pleased to honor their engagement and outstanding achievements in delivering technical expertise and consultancy on the unified SolarWinds Platform. This year, our partners will embark on a journey towards excellent customer experience, allowing customers to effectively use SolarWindsObservability (Self-Hosted and SaaS), Database, and IT Service Management (ITSM) solutions as they manage increasingly complex digital landscapes.”

The complete list of winners is as follows:

· EMEA Distributor of the Year: Spire Solutions (UAE)

· EMEA Partner of the Year: Consolit Bilişim Teknolojileri (TR)

· EMEA Breakthrough Award: CDW (UK)

· EMEA Excellence in Customer Retention: Veridata (DK)

· EMEA Excellence in New Business Development: Prologic (IL)

· EMEA Excellence in Diversification: Delta Line International (UAE)

· EMEA Excellence in Marketing: ODYA Teknoloji (TR)

· EMEA Personal Achievement: Waleed Odeh from Clever Solutions (KSA)

· EMEA Excellence in Enablement: Prosperon Networks Limited (UK)

· EMEA Observability Partner of the Year: Loop1 (UK)

The winners were determined based on revenue and year-over-year growth trajectory, investment in SolarWinds, development commitment and technology alignment, effectiveness in collaboration with SolarWinds field organisations regionally, effectiveness of marketing campaigns and go-to-market strategies, and SolarWinds Certified Professional® and SolarWinds Sales Expert (SSE) accreditations over the past year.
